WebMar 20, 2024 · Six Sigma is a system of quality management processes that aims to make operations more effective by reducing defects. The basic aim of Six Sigma is to make a process 99.99996% defect-free. This means a Six Sigma process produces 3.4 defects per million opportunities (or less) as a result.
